their has been a plethora of tests in the past, by testing faster memory speeds (from 2400 mhz - 4000 mhz), and the results are pretty much negligible between them.

 

3200 mhz is the optimal speed (is the conclusion, but it really does not matter in the grand scheme of things, your CPU and GPU is far more important, and will make a much bigger impact), anything faster then that is redundant, and is only like 1 fps better.

 

and likewise 2400 mhz (the default speed for ddr4) is also perfectly sufficient, the difference between 2400 mhz and 3200mhz is largely negligible as well. maybe like 5 fps, which in the grand scheme of things is redundant, as a good Fast CPU, GPU and SSD, is more then capable of giving you fps from 60 and way past 120 fps, so this little 5 fps speed increase with regards to memory you wont even notice at all, especially when your fps is already beyond 120 fps due to strong powerful components (CPU and GPU).

 

with that said, i do actually run XMP myself, and it does improve performance in MMOs (outside of MMOs however it is completely not noticed, my machine runs extremely fast anyway, with or without XMP). the default XMP overclock, is perfectly fine on my system at least.

 

all XMP does by default is overclock your memory to its advertised speed. but it also allows you the user to now overclock your memory, beyond its advertised speed.

 

however what makes it risky, is XMP will also increases how much Power the Memory consumes, and that is where the risk is, because most automated overclocking processes, usually give the components much more power then they actually need, which is incredibly risky.

 

Your motherboard manufacturer are the ones that would have set how much power the components are given when automated overclocking is enabled (XMP, Turbo Boost, etc etc) and for the most part they always give more power then necessary, which is the problem.

 

back in the DDR2 days faster memory made an impact, but memory is so fast by default nowadays it is now redundant. especially when we factor in other hardware, that is far more important and will make much bigger impact.

I had been experiencing random freezing eerily similar to what icestormng was having: almost always when engaged in combat (not in VATS, mind you), or when nearby enemies were aggroed, mostly in interior cells (twice in the same location in Fort Hagen on different characters). I was starting to learn towards a hardware related issue as I never had these problems before building a new rig in January (my first build). The freezes occur on all characters across multiple FO4 installs on the system. Trying all the black magic and mod dissecting I could muster didn’t resolve the issue. I had been at my wits end trying to track it down.

 

But after reading this thread and finding that my BIOS did in fact have an XMP profile active, I disabled it and have had a collective 8-ish hours of freeze free gameplay, with loads and loads of combat. The XMP profile was rated at 3200 MHz, but it’s now running at the apparently more stable rate of 2666. The mobo is a Gigabyte Z390 Aorus Master. hi guys, so it turns out that my XMP was never actually enabled (ever, could of sworn i enabled back in the day for ESO but that may have actually been my old computer i did it on) lol, anywho, it can actually make a huge difference in performance. i decided to test it enabled and disabled and here are the results:

 

Fallout 4 Completely unmodded, title screen (i am using an enb - using the title screen as to eliminate the GPU Bound areas) - uncapped frame rate

 

i7 7700k @4.5 Ghz (turbo boost) - Dram 2133 (XMP Disabled) = 660 FPS min - 665 fps Max

 

i7 7700k @4.5 GHz (turbo boost) - Dram 2666 (XPM Enabled) = 685 FPS Min - 690 Fps Max

 

so yea, 25 fps boost by enabling it, that is pretty damn significant boost in performance, this can result in going from 35 fps to 60 fps, just by enabling XMP

 

unknown how stable this will be in the long run, but my motherboard can handle upto 3800 dram, and my dram is rated for 2666 mhz and is still operating with the same safe 1.2 v on memory.

 

however the i7 7700k limit is 2400 mhz dram. so yes 2666 is definitely overclocking.
